北美微载体市场预计将从2022年的7.3667亿美元增长到2030年的19.3356亿美元。预计2022年至2030年复合年增长率为12.8%。细胞和基因治疗制造服务的自动化推动北美发展微载体市场在细胞和基因治疗制造中采用自动化将降低污染风险、提高一致性并降低生产成本。 Lonza Cocoon 和 Miltenyi 的 CliniMACS Prodigy 系统是市场上现有的一些设备,这些设备旨在实现单个系统内 CAR-T 流程的大多数顺序单元操作的自动化。对细胞和基因疗法不断增长的需求已将全球范围内的生产从小批量工艺转向大批量工艺。细胞和基因治疗从学术和临床环境到大规模生产和商业化的进展进一步推动了商业制造对自动化的需求。 2020 年 7 月,Thermo Fisher Scientific Inc. 和 Lyell Nutrition 合作开发流程,为癌症患者设计有效的细胞疗法。根据这一合作伙伴关系,两家公司的目标是提高 T 细胞的能力,并支持开发符合现行良好生产规范 (cGMP) 的综合平台(系统和软件)以及试剂、耗材和仪器。此外,美国政府援助的组织正在细胞疗法的制造中采用自动化,以提高该国的国家生产能力。因此,自动化正在成为微载体市场的新趋势。北美微载体市场概述北美微载体市场分为美国、加拿大和墨西哥。美国在该地区市场占据主导地位。北美微载体市场的增长归因于生物技术和生物制药公司推出的产品数量不断增加、主要市场参与者的存在以及各个学术和研究机构的广泛研发。慢性病患病率的上升是推动美国微载体市场增长的主要因素。根据美国疾病控制与预防中心 (CDC) 的数据,十分之六的美国人患有至少一种慢性疾病,例如心脏病、中风、癌症或糖尿病。这些疾病是美国死亡和残疾的重要原因,而且还导致巨大的医疗费用。细胞和基因疗法(CGT)领域取得了广泛的临床进展,因此这些疗法的应用范围在过去5年中不断扩大。在 2016 年至 2021 年的分析期间,随着 12 种新疗法的批准和超过 2,900 项临床试验的启动,CGT 创新得到了广泛的投资。基因编辑技术的进步,以及评估该技术治疗效果的临床试验,是有利于美国微载体市场的其他因素。例如,Poseida Therapeutics, Inc. 的 P-CD19CD20-ALLO1 的研究性新药 (IND) 申请获得美国食品和药物管理局 (FDA) 批准,这是该公司首款同时靶向 CD19 和 CD19 的同种异体双 CAR-T 细胞候选产品。与罗氏合作开发用于治疗复发或难治性 B 细胞恶性肿瘤的 CD20 抗原。 2023 年 4 月,新型同种异体 CAR T 细胞疗法在转移性透明细胞肾细胞癌患者中取得了成果。因此,增加临床试验的参与和投资可以加速新疗法的采用和可用性。德克萨斯大学 MD 安德森癌症中心的研究人员领导了 I 期试验,并在美国癌症研究协会 (AACR) 2023 年年会上进行了报告。2023 年 8 月,安斯泰来制药公司和 Poseida Therapeutics, Inc. 宣布对支持 Poseida 重新定义癌细胞疗法的承诺。安斯泰来投资 5000 万美元获得 Poseida 一项临床阶段项目的许可,该项目专注于 P-MUC1C-ALLO1,这是一种用于多种实体瘤适应症的同种异体 CAR T 细胞疗法。因此,随着慢性病病例数量的增加以及不同细胞和基因疗法的批准,美国对微载体的需求正在增加。北美微载体市场收入和预测到 2030 年(百万美元) 北美微载体市场细分 北美微载体市场分为产品、设备、应用、最终用户和国家。根据产品,北美微载体市场分为微载体珠和培养基和试剂。 2022年,微载体珠细分市场在北美微载体市场中占据较大份额。在设备方面,北美微载体市场分为生物反应器、培养容器等。 2022年,生物反应器领域在北美微载体市场中占据最大份额。根据应用,北美微载体市场分为生物制药生产、细胞和基因治疗、组织工程和再生医学等。 2022年,生物制药生产领域在北美微载体市场中占据最大份额。此外,生物制药生产领域分为治疗性蛋白生产和疫苗生产。根据最终用户,北美微载体市场分为制药和生物技术公司、合同研究组织和合同制造组织以及学术和研究机构。 2022 年,制药和生物技术公司细分市场占据北美微载体市场的最大份额。按国家/地区划分,北美微载体市场分为美国、加拿大和墨西哥。 2022 年,美国将主导北美微载体市场。Teijin Ltd、Bio-Rad Laboratories Inc、Sartorius AG、Danaher Corp、Corning Inc、Eppendorf SE、Asahi Kasei Corp 和 Polysciences Inc 是在北美运营的一些领先公司微载体市场。
